The SPSB0815-TR from STMicroelectronics is an Automotive Qualified Power Management IC that is ideal for body control modules (BCM), telemetry control units, control panels, seat control modules, sunroof modules, passive keyless entry and start modules, fuel pumps, gear shifters, and gateway applications. It requires an input voltage of up to 28 V and provides an output current of less than 1.25 A. This IC consists of a driver interface with logic and diagnostic capabilities, an LDO regulator, a voltage tracker, P-channel HS drivers, thermal clusters, protection circuitries, and serial interfaces such as SPI, CAN-FD, and LIN. It uses one LDO regulator to supply power to the system’s microcontroller and a voltage tracker to supply power to external peripheral loads such as sensors. This power management IC integrates two separate pins for contact monitoring via the two channels and also supports programmable cyclic sense functionality. It uses the four HS drivers to supply a fixed amount of power either to the external LED modules with high input capacitance value or other external contacts.
This AEC-Q100-qualified IC integrates diagnostic pins at the output side to enable fail-safe signalization along with open-load diagnosis for all the outputs. It includes protection circuitries such as over-current protection (OCP), over-voltage detection/protection, and a programmable reset generator for power-on and under-voltage lockout (UVLO), thereby preventing over-load or false trigger events. This IC further supports temperature warning and protection with thermal clusters, improving the overall reliability over the operating temperature range. It is available in a surface-mount package that measures 5.0 x 5.0 x 1.0 mm.
